How Much Money Is Left Behind In Tsa Bins Every Year Where Does The Money Go What About All The Snow Globes Guns And Grenades

The Transportation Security Administration, more commonly referred to as the TSA, was established on November 19, 2001, and was originally part of the United States Department of Transportation. In March of 2003, it became a branch of Homeland Security. The purpose of the organization is to develop policies and practices focused on airport security, the prevention of hijacking, and security and safety with regards to all modes of transportation, including railroads, buses, mass transit, ports, etc....

Joe Francis Just Lost 50 Million

This whole mess started in 2007 when the Francis honcho ran up a $2 million debt over several days of gambling at The Wynn in Las Vegas. After returning home (and most likely coming to his senses), Francis refused to pay the bill. Joe claimed that The Wynn used hookers and other “deceptive practices” to keep him gambling even as his losses mounted higher and higher. When it was clear Joe was not going to pay his bill willingly, Steve Wynn took him to court, initially just suing for the $2 million debt....

John Krasinski Net Worth

The Office Salary For the first three seasons of “The Office,” John Krasinski’s salary was $20,000 per episode. He then began making $100,000 per episode in season 4 and continued earning that much through the rest of the series. Jack Ryan Salary Between his acting salary and producing fee, John Krasinski earned $2.5 million per episode of the third season of “Jack Ryan.” The third season had eight episodes, so John earned $20 million in total....

Most Expensive Divorce Ever Russian Billionaire Dmitry Rybolovlev Will Pay Ex Wife 4 5 Billion

Earlier today, a Swiss judge ordered Dmitry Rybolovlev to pay his ex-wife Elena a $4.5 billion divorce settlement. Technically he was ordered to pay Elena 4,020,555,987.80 Swiss francs which is equal to 4,505,833,074.97 USD. OUCH. Elena and Dmitry met while both were students in Perm, Russia. They married in 1987 and Elena first filed for divorce in 2008. Dmitry is known in Russia as the “fertilizer king”. He earned his place as one of the richest people in Russia by privatizing the potash fertilizer company Uralkali....

Robyn Gibson Net Worth

Robyn met Mel Gibson in the 1970s when they both were renting rooms in the same house in Adelaide, Australia. At the time they met, Robyn was working as a dental nurse and Mel was an unknown, struggling actor. They stayed together even as Mel’s career and fame exploded thanks largely to his role in 1979’s Mad Max. Robyn and Mel eventually were married for over 30 years. Technically she filed for divorced in 2006 but the divorce wasn’t officially finalized until 2011....
